About The Position

The WIC Registered Dietitian provides professional program management and supervisory work within the WIC program. Responsibilities include program direction and leadership, long- and short-term planning for clinic sites, quality approval, and policy development to ensure quality services that meet federal and state guidelines within the clinic setting. In collaboration with the WIC Director, seeks grant opportunities and executes special grant projects focused on community nutrition and outreach.

Responsibilities

  • Coordinates and directs the work of the staff on a regular basis; assigns work and reviews staff workloads and productivity at least monthly. Utilizes appropriate methods for interacting sensitively. Effectively and professionally work with people with diverse cultural backgrounds.
  • Recruits and hire new staff and oversees the orientation of new staff
  • Establishes and maintains effective working relationships with staff, community organizations, the public, and various stakeholders. Participate in certain community task forces and committees.
  • Manages staff utilizing mentoring, coaching, and other appropriate supervisory techniques; evaluates staff performance, counsels staff, and recommends disciplinary action as needed. Maintains staff confidentiality as a professional, appropriately. Recognizes and creates learning opportunities for the staff.
  • Assesses the knowledge and skill level of the staff and develops strategies to address any needs and to maximize their skills and abilities
  • Ensure staff attend required state and local agency training; ensure staff have appropriate certifications and training as required by the Maryland Department of Health.
  • Develops, implements, and monitors the annual Nutrition Education Plan.
  • Develops, implements, and monitors the Breastfeeding Promotion Program.
  • Plans, conducts, and evaluates secondary Nutrition Education.
  • Develops Nutrition Education and Breastfeeding Promotion materials (i.e., brochures, posters, and community notices).
  • Provides high-risk counseling to WIC participants.
  • Provides individual and group counseling for breastfeeding participants.
  • Plans, conducts, and evaluates staff in-service education for nutrition education and breastfeeding promotion.
  • Assists the WIC Program Director in the evaluation of staff competencies in nutrition education.
  • Assists in the development and implementation of the annual Outreach Plan.
  • Acts as liaison between GBMS and the State WIC Nutrition Education and Breastfeeding Specialists.
  • Perform certifications and other clinic activities as needed.
  • Participates in team/staff meetings; attends in-service meetings and applicable workshops.
